Administrative Law; Health and Human Services Commission; Licenses, Certificates, and Permits; Business Entities; Licensing Agencies' Authority; State Boards, Commissions, Departments; Statutory and Constitutional Construction; Intent
KP-0497
Texas Attorney General Opinion
The Health and Human Services Commission’s statutory authority to license and regulate Individualized Skills and Socialization providers under chapter 103 of the Human Resources Code, as well as whether administrative penalties assessed on DAHS facility-licensed ISS providers is capped by the amounts in subsections 103.012(b) and 103.013(c)
